Crochet toys mittens Many boys in preschool age passcraze for dragons and dinosaurs. Especially for them, we suggest crocheting toys-mittens in the form of dragons. However, this is a universal model: the other ears, the mane - and now we are faced with not a dragon, but a horse or zebra. But today, we knit it shooters. Toys mittens dragons

To tie the dragons, I needed:

Kartopu Gonca acrylic yarn (100 g = 300 m)dark green, light green, red, blue, black and white; hook No. 2.5 (on the label the recommended hook size is No. 4); scissors; sewing needle and sewing thread to match the yarn.

Crochet dragon mittens: a job description

1 row. Knit the body of dragons dark green yarn. 40 inc. close the ring to the ring. On one side of the chain, we knit a border - teeth or festoons. Trim edge Edge trimming scheme Dental teeth: * 3 inc. lifting, 3 tbsp. double crochet previous row; Art. without nakida after 2 v.p. from the base of double crochets * - repeat from * to * to the end of the row. Festoons: * 5 tbsp. double crochet previous row (one ce from the top of the first double crochet, and later from the single crochet); Art. without nakida in vp one from the base of the fan with double crochets * - repeat from * to * to the end of the row. We make strapping and knit without decreasing Finished with the edging of the bottom edge of the mittens - and go to the knitting of the dragon's body. 2-24 rows. In a circle, we knit along the second side of the initial chain of air loops with columns without crochet 23 rows. Lower part mittens 25 row. We knit 20 vs, then a single crochet through 20 columns of the previous row; then another 19 posts without crochet. Select the jaw 26-41 rows. In a circle with columns without nakida (i.e., we add another 16 rows). 26th row knit incl. along the chain of ce, capturing only one side of the chain. Knit dragon face Begin to narrow the face of the dragon. To do this, we reduce to 2 tbsp. in each row at the edges of the palm. 42 row: 48-2 = 38 Art. without nakida 43 range: 38-2 = 36 tbsp. without nakida, etc .: in the last 51st row we will have 20 st. without nakida Narrowing the Dragon's Face We turn the mitten, align the mitten and tie the two halves with single crochets. Tying edge We turn it to the front. We turn on the front side Moving on to knitting the lower jaw. It consists of 14 rows. We return to the slit for the lower jaw. We tie it with single crochets. The row will consist of 40 columns without single crochet. Thus, we knit 4 rows in a circle, and then knit 10 more rows, in each of which we remove 1 tbsp. At the edges. without nakida (i.e. 2 columns in each row). Knit the lower jaw We narrow the lower jaw Then turn the lower jaw inside out, fold both sides of the row and knit them together, connecting them with single crochets. We turn on the face. Tying stitch Wrenched Mitten-bases for toys are ready. Base mittens We supply the animals with dragon ridges. I made in two versions: single light green and double dark green. The first one fits in the same way as a jagged bezel (the same scheme). 30 ce, * 3 tbsp. with nakida in 4th century v. from the edge; single crochet in ce one from the base of the fan *. Repeat from * to * until the end of the row; at the end there will still be a few free loops - tie them over with a single crochet. Single row dragon crest The second one fits in the same way as a scalloped edging, but on both sides of the chain of air loops. Double row comb 28 para. * 5 Art. double crochet at the end of the cept .; 1 tbsp. without nakida in vp through one * - repeat from * to * to the end of the row; expand and repeat on the second side of the initial chain of ce Dragon crest One of our dragons is eared. Knit ear. Dragon ear pattern Description of knitting ear. 1 row. 5 vp plus 1 v.p. on a turn. 2 row. 3 tbsp. double crochet, 2 blind loops. 3 row. 1 vp on a turn, 2 deaf loops and 3 tbsp. nakida for the front half. 4 row. 1 vp on a turn; 3 tbsp. with double crochet and 2 blind loops for the back half loop. 5 row - as the third. 6 row - as the fourth. Then go to the narrow "end" of the ear; do 2 tbsp. without crochet, knitted together, thus tightening the narrow part of the ear. Dragon ears Blue specks knit very simply: 8 tbsp. without nakida around the amigurumi ring, close the row with a deaf loop, tighten the hole. Blue specks The spots on the dragon's skin The eyes of the dragons are bicoloured, black and white. We knit like this: black yarn - 12 tbsp. without nakida around the amigurumi ring; tie a white yarn in a circle, blind loops. At the end of the row, make 1 column, without crochet, by inserting a hook into the center of the amigurumi ring. Ring tighten. Eyes Knit the red tongue. 8 vp + 1 incl. on a turn; 7 single crochet; 5 tbsp. nakida in the last air loop; 6 tbsp. nakida on the second side of the initial chain of air loops; additional 2 inc. (one of them to turn) - a single crochet on this air loop. Close a row inside a deaf loop - a forked tongue turned out. Tongue I advise you to steam all the elements with an iron from a purlside through a damp cloth, and then sew: tongues - in the mouth; crest - in the center of the back; To equip one dragon with spots, and another - with ears. And, of course, sew eyes and embroider nostrils.
